might-have-been
 
PRONUNCIATION:mtv-bn
NOUN:Inflected forms: pl. might-have-beens (-bnz)
An event that could have but never did occur: “This is one of the great might-have-beens of modern history” (Arthur M. Schlesinger, Jr.).
